ZDI-25-478: (0Day) INVT VT-Designer PM3 File Parsing Out-Of-Bounds Write Remote Code Execution Vulnerability

by Deepanshu Jha
This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of INVT VT-Designer.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The ZDI has assigned a CVSS rating of 7.8. The following CVEs are assigned: CVE-2025-7227.
